    A Rare Treat! RENEE TAYLOR & JOSEPH BOLOGNA in "MADE FOR EACH OTHER" [[1971)

    Directed by Robert B. Bean
    Written by Renee Taylor & Joseph Bologna

    [[96 mins.)

    Hope those of you who have watched the movie have enjoyed it. It's one of those that I love for many reasons and never tire of seeing.

    You might be interested to know that in the group encounter scene, the older woman wearing the brown & orange dress who's seated next to Joseph Bologna is Freeda Wexler, real mother of Renee Taylor.
